32:26-11.  Legislative findings
    The Legislature finds that:

    (a) The public safety necessitates the continuous development, modernization  and implementation of standards and requirements of law relating to vehicle  equipment, in accordance with expert knowledge and opinion.

    (b) The public safety further requires that such standards and requirements  be uniform from jurisdiction to jurisdiction, except to the extent that  specific and compelling evidence supports variation.

    (c) The procedures provided by the vehicle equipment safety compact and by other provisions of this section in implementation thereof provide a just, equitable and orderly means of promoting the public safety in the manner and within the scope contemplated by the public policy of this State.

     L.1964, c. 54, s. 2.
